
TMK announced that its TMK-Premium Service division began supplying TMK-PF ET premium threaded casing connections to Surgutneftegas.
According to the release, the first shipment of TMK-PF ET to Surgutneftegas consisted of 120 tonnes of premium threaded 168 mm casing with 8.94 mm wall thickness. In addition to the PF series, TMK-Premium Service will supply Surgutneftegas with TMK-GF premium connections and provide technical assistance during operations. TMK expects total shipment volumes of premium class products to Surgutneftegas to surpass 800 tonnes by the end of the 2008.
TMK-PF ET premium threaded casing connections are intended for use in highly-deviated and horizontal wells in complex geological structures. The TMK-PF series offers extra gas tightness and high resistance to tensile and bending stresses.
This latest generation of TMK premium connections was designed and produced by TMK-Premium Service and certified by the Scientific-Research Institute of Natural Gases and Gas Technologies for use in challenging environments.
In 2007, TMK shipped a total of 187,300 tonnes of pipe products, including premium connections, to Surgutneftegas. The supply of tubular goods falls under a long term strategic partnership agreement between the two companies. TMK plans to supply a total of 20,500 tonnes of tubular goods to Surgutneftegas in 2008.
In addition to the TMK-PF series, TMK-Premium Service offers a wide range of patented casing and tubing connections developed by TMK R&D specialists and designed for onshore and offshore exploration, appraisal and production drilling in challenging environments.
